VISION STATEMENT

         Suburban Jewish Community Center Bnai Aaron is a warm, ruach-filled, haimishe, traditional egalitarian Conservative congregation, striving to meet the intellectual, social and spiritual needs of our congregants by combining a commitment to innovation with respect for halacha.

          SJCCBA is a Beyt K'nesset (House of Gathering), a Beyt T'fillah (House of Prayer) and a Beyt Midrash (House of Study) rolled into one.  Our synagogue offers multiple entry points for members. While some will be more inclined to come to synagogue for social reasons or to engage in tikkun olam (social action), others might be more inclined to participate in our religious and educational activities.

          People of all Jewish backgrounds and at different stages of their religious journeys are encouraged to be part of our community.  Individuals are encouraged to approach the mitzovt (commandments) the way we would approach a ladder, climbing up one rung at a time.  As Conservative Jews, we may not all be on the same rung of the ladder as the next person; each of us will climb the ladder of mitzvot at a different pace, "willing, learning and striving" to be somewhere on that ladder.  By observing mitzvot such as studying, praying and participating in acts of gemilut chasidim and social action, we have the opportunity to maintain and strengthen our Jewish identities, to develop a closer relationship with God, and to connect to the Jewish community around the world and throughout Jewish history.

          Not only do we have the potential for spiritual and intellectual growth as individuals, but we also have a tremendous potential for growth as a community.  We continually strive to be a cutting-edge, education centered, spiritual community that is known for its welcoming, inclusive, energizing, and engaging ruach-filled atmosphere.
